Tottenham Hotspur are reportedly interested in securing the services of Turkish defender Ridvan Yilmaz from Besiktas in the summer.

According to a report from Turkish publication TRT Spor, Tottenham Hotspur have entered the race to sign Besiktas youngster Ridvan Yilmaz in the upcoming transfer window.

Having come through the youth ranks at Besiktas, Yilmaz made his first-team debut in 2019 at the age of 17 and has gradually grown into a regular in the starting lineup over the past couple of years. The 20-year-old has played 59 matches in all competitions, scoring four goals and setting up seven more.

Yilmaz has enjoyed a positive 2021/22 term, putting up a return of three goals and four assists in 24 league matches. The youngster broke into the Turkish national team last year and has made six appearances already. His gradual rise to prominence has not gone unnoticed as clubs from across Europe have taken note of his talents.

Indeed, there is interest from Lyon in France and Atalanta in Italy, while Premier League giants Tottenham Hotspur have also shown a liking towards Yilmaz ahead of the summer transfer window.

Tottenham have three players who can play at left-back in the form of Ben Davies, Sergio Reguilon and Ryan Sessegnon. Among the trio, Davies has been regularly used as a left-sided centre-back, whereas Reguilon and Sessegnon have shared game-time as the left wing-back. However, neither have been consistent enough to nail down the spot for themselves.

In addition, Reguilon is linked with a return to La Liga, with Barcelona interested in the former Real Madrid left-back. Furthermore, reports have indicated that Antonio Conte would be open to offloading the Spanish international. Such a move would create an opening for a new left wing-back at the Tottenham Hotspur Stadium.

Yilmaz, to that end, has emerged as an enticing target for the north London outfit. The 20-year-old has excelled playing in the wing-back role for Besiktas and has the attacking capabilities to thrive in Conte’s system at Tottenham. Furthermore, he is entering the final year of his contract with the Turkish club at the end of the season and could be available for a bargain in the summer.

It remains to be seen if Tottenham act on their reported interest in Yilmaz in the summer or decide to look at other options if they decide to sell Reguilon.
